WebMar 10, 2024 · Similar to homeownership, property taxes can be an easy write-off during tax season. If a timeshare owner pays some of the property tax, they’re able to write it off as an itemized deduction on Schedule A using a 1098 tax form. The IRS gives fractional owners the right to deduct property taxes based on the actual value of the unit. WebTimeshare is the ownership of a vacation product as a unit of time to access different resorts or as an interest of shared ownership of a vacation property at a specific resort. The first timeshares began as sharing ownership of a fixed week and has evolved into flexible products using points.

WebMar 27, 2024 · Timeshares, introduced in the United States in 1969, are a way to buy the right to use a vacation property for a specific amount of time. That means no true property ownership and no gained equity. Because dozens of parties own the same timeshares, a single unit could have up to 52 owners. A timeshare is usually a purchase that is intended to eliminate hotel expenses. dr talamonti north shoreWebExchanging Timeshare Points With points-based ownership, you can essentially use your points to “buy” time at other resorts. Generally, as long as you have enough points for the resort you want to stay at, you can stay there (depending, of course, on resort and unit availability.)
